When Oracle TDE switches to another master or clone server, the Oracle Wallet closes because of the database restart. To get the TDE master key, the Oracle Wallet must be open. To avoid the need to open the wallet each time you restart the database, configure auto-login.
Oracle Restart is a new feature that provides the ability to monitor, manage, and automatically restart the Oracle components, including the Oracle Database Single Instance, Oracle Net Listener, database services and Oracle ASM.
The Oracle Database agent provides monitoring capabilities for the availability, performance, and resource usage of the Oracle database. You can configure more than one Oracle Database instance to monitor different Oracle databases. The remote monitoring capability is also provided by this agent.
